SECTION D
HOUSING
Statistics relating to action taken under the Housing
Acts have been prepared on lines suggested in Circular 1650
issued by the Minister of Health and are shewn on pages 24
and 25. In addition, the summaries that have appeared in
previous annual reports shewing the action taken in regard
to (a) clearance areas, and (b) "individual" houses found
to be unfit for human habitation, have been revised again
to shew the positions at the end of 1937.
The following table gives particulars of building development
during the year :—
(1) Number of new houses erected by the
Corporation during the year ended 31st
December, 1937 32 Flats
(2) Number of houses erected by private
enterprise during the year ended 31st
December, 1937 70 Houses
121 Flats
(3) Total number of houses for the workingclasses
erected by the Corporation since
March, 1924 732 Houses
56 Flats
